Parameter | Name:

C00118 | DigOutX: Inversion

Data type: UNSIGNED_8

Index: 24457

d

= 5F89

h

The polarity of each digital output of the device can be inverted via this bit field.

Digital output terminals

Setting range

(min. hex value | max. hex value)

Lenze setting

0x00

0xFF 0x00 (decimal: 0)

Value is bit-coded: (= bit set)

Info

Bit 0  Relay inverted

Relay inversion

Bit 1  DO1 inverted

Inversion of digital output 1

Bit 2  DO2 inverted

Inversion of digital output 2

Bit 3  DO3 inverted

Inversion of digital output 3

Bit 4  High current inverted

Inversion of high-current output

Bit 5 

Reserved

Bit 6 

Reserved

Bit 7 

Reserved

Parameter | Name:

C00120 | Setting of motor overload (I²xt)

Data type: INTEGER_16

Index: 24455

d

= 5F87

h

Operating threshold for the "OC6: Motor overload (I²xt)" error message

• The response for reaching the threshold can be selected in

C00606

.

• The current thermal motor load is displayed in

C00066

.

Motor overload monitoring (I2xt)

Setting range

(min. value | unit | max. value)

Lenze setting

0.00

%

250.00 100.00 %
